Chicken Dumpling Casserole
The Captain makes the best Chicken and Dumplings from scratch that I have ever had. But, like most everything made from scratch, it takes hours to make. I will post his recipe soon because it really is worth it when you have the time. (It breaks my heart to say he never wrote his recipe down for me and now he is gone. Lesson learned to not put things off because it may be too late.)
This recipe is one of those semi-homemade meals that I love so much. Sometimes you just don't have the time to slave away for hours in the kitchen. Cream of chicken soup is one of my favorite methods of making a delicious meal fast and easy. Grocery store rotisserie chicken is another secret to a fast and delicious meal. Of course making your own chicken is more economical!
UPDATE and REVIEW:
The name of the recipe is deceiving. It is more like a Chicken and Biscuits Casserole or add some vegetables and call it a Chicken Ala King Casserole.
The biscuit topping that forms is not thick like a biscuit, but is very tasty and somewhat crunchy. We loved it. It produces a gravy that is thick and a nice compliment to the chicken and biscuit topping. I've never added chicken broth to cream of chicken soup and was pleasantly surprised.
We served it over mashed potatoes, which was a great choice and I highly recommend it for a day you are in the mood for delicious comfort food that is a fast and easy meal to prepare.
The plan for the next time it is made . . . double the flour, baking soda mixture for the biscuit topping and add cooked vegetables like corn, peas, carrots or green beans.

Pineapple Upside-Down Cake
"That unique presentation is everything: Pineapple upside-down cake is baked with rings of canned pineapple slices that become sticky and sweet during their time in the oven. After baking, the cake gets inverted in one big flip so that the pineapple rounds end up topping the cake as its displayed upside down—or right side up, depending on your point of view. A cherry in the center of each pineapple ring adds a whimsical polka-dot sensibility to the cake." - comment from Southern Living about the cake.
This cake brings back so many childhood memories. My nana made it a couple times every month. I had forgotten about this delicious cake with an awesome presentation.

Homemade Corn Tortillas
"These corn tortillas are the real thing! A simple mixture of masa harina and water results in the most wonderful corn tortillas you've ever tasted. The secret is to use a cast iron pan." comment about corn tortillas recipe from All Recipes.
The Captain and I made homemade corn tortillas all the time. They were excellent even using a stainless steel frying pan. The difference between homemade and store bought is like night and day. We made tortilla chips using the same dough.
